Palatine Township Republican Fundraiser

Palatine Township Republican slate holds fundraiser on Monday, April 1st at Emmett's Ale House.

Palatine Township’s Republican slate of candidates is holding a fundraiser for their campaign on Monday, April 1st from 5:30 PM until 7:30 PM at Emmett’s Ale House located at 110 North Brockway Street in Palatine.

“Come out, have a drink and appetizers with our slate of candidates that will be running in the April 9th election,” said Sharon Langlotz-Johnson, Palatine Township Trustee and candidate for Township Supervisor.  “Come out, meet the candidates that are looking to lead our Township and help us ensure a Republican victory on election day.”

The slate is endorsed by the Palatine Township Republican Organization, the official Republican organization of Palatine Township, the Save Briarwood Committee and Aaron Del Mar, Cook County GOP Chairman.  The slate includes Sharon Langlotz-Johnson for Township Supervisor, Tom Kaider for Highway Commissioner and Bill Pohlman, Art Goes, Kevin McGrane as well as Bill Huley for Trustee.

“The Republican slate of candidates for Palatine Township slate is running for office because for too long Township government hasn’t had the proper respect for the public’s tax dollars,” said Langlotz-Johnson.  “We understand that it is the taxpayers’ money that we are spending and as a result we must spend it wisely and conservatively.”
